Advanced Materials<\/h3>\n<p>One of the most significant trends in head protection is the use of advanced materials. Traditional helmets were often made of basic plastics and foams, but now, we&#8217;re seeing some really high &#8211; tech stuff.<\/p>\n<p>Carbon fiber is becoming increasingly popular. It&#8217;s incredibly strong yet lightweight. This means that a carbon &#8211; fiber helmet can offer excellent protection without weighing the user down. Whether it&#8217;s for cyclists, motorcyclists, or industrial workers, a lighter helmet means less fatigue over time. For example, in the cycling world, pro riders are always looking for that extra edge, and a lightweight carbon &#8211; fiber helmet can give them a speed advantage while keeping their heads safe.<\/p>\n<p>Another cool material is Kevlar. Known for its use in bulletproof vests, Kevlar is now being incorporated into head protection. It has great impact &#8211; resistant properties and can withstand high &#8211; energy impacts. In industrial settings where there&#8217;s a risk of falling objects, Kevlar &#8211; reinforced helmets are a game &#8211; changer. They can prevent serious head injuries that could otherwise have long &#8211; term consequences for the workers.<\/p>\n<h3>2. Smart Helmets<\/h3>\n<p>The era of smart technology has hit the head protection industry, and it&#8217;s here to stay. Smart helmets are packed with features that go beyond just protecting your head.<\/p>\n<p>Many smart helmets now come with built &#8211; in sensors. These sensors can detect impacts and send an alert to a pre &#8211; set emergency contact if the impact is severe enough. This is a huge deal, especially for extreme sports enthusiasts like skiers and snowboarders. If they take a bad fall and are unconscious on the slopes, the smart helmet can quickly get help on the way.<\/p>\n<p>Some smart helmets also have integrated cameras. For cyclists, this is a great feature. They can record their rides, which is not only fun for sharing on social media but also useful for safety. If there&#8217;s an accident, the video footage can provide valuable evidence. In the construction industry, workers can use the integrated cameras to record their work progress and document any safety hazards.<\/p>\n<h2>3. Customization<\/h2>\n<p>Gone are the days when everyone had to settle for a one &#8211; size &#8211; fits &#8211; all helmet. Customization is a big trend in the head protection market.<\/p>\n<p>Customers now want helmets that not only fit perfectly but also reflect their personal style. We&#8217;re seeing more and more options for custom &#8211; fitting helmets. Some suppliers are using 3D scanning technology to create a digital model of the customer&#8217;s head and then manufacturing a helmet that fits like a glove. This not only ensures maximum comfort but also better protection, as a properly &#8211; fitting helmet is less likely to move around during an impact.<\/p>\n<p>In terms of style, there&#8217;s a wide range of colors, patterns, and designs available. This not only benefits the environment but also saves the customer money in the long term.<\/p>\n<h3>5. Integration with Other Safety Gear<\/h3>\n<p>Head protection doesn&#8217;t work in isolation. It needs to work in harmony with other safety gear, and that&#8217;s where integration comes in.<\/p>\n<p>For example, in the military and law enforcement sectors, helmets are now being designed to integrate with other equipment like night &#8211; vision goggles, communication devices, and face shields. This seamless integration allows for better functionality and increased safety. A soldier or police officer can quickly switch between different modes of operation without having to worry about the gear not working together properly.<\/p>\n<p>In the industrial world, helmets are being designed to work with respirators and ear protection. This is important because workers often need to protect their heads, lungs, and ears simultaneously. A well &#8211; integrated system ensures that all the safety gear functions effectively without causing any discomfort or interference.<\/p>\n<h3>6.
